.title-size-xxxxs{font-size:14px;line-height:22px}.title-size-xxxs{font-size:16px;line-height:24px}.title-size-xxs{font-size:20px;line-height:28px}.title-size-xs{font-size:24px;line-height:32px}.title-size-s{font-size:28px;line-height:36px}.title-size-m{font-size:40px;line-height:48px;font-weight:700}.title-size-l{font-size:52px;line-height:60px}.title-size-xl{font-size:60px;line-height:68px}.fw-600{font-weight:600}*,:after,:before{-webkit-box-sizing:border-box;box-sizing:border-box}.general-wrapper{overflow:hidden}.wrapper{max-width:1260px;padding:0 15px;margin-left:auto;margin-right:auto}.push-size-xxxs:not(:last-child){margin-bottom:8px}.push-size-xxs:not(:last-child){margin-bottom:16px}.push-size-xs:not(:last-child){margin-bottom:24px}.push-size-s:not(:last-child){margin-bottom:32px}.push-size-m:not(:last-child){margin-bottom:40px}.push-size-l:not(:last-child){margin-bottom:48px}.push-size-xl:not(:last-child){margin-bottom:56px}.push-size-xxl:not(:last-child){margin-bottom:64px}.push-size-xxxl:not(:last-child){margin-bottom:72px}.push-size-xxxxl:not(:last-child){margin-bottom:80px}.push-size-xxxxxl:not(:last-child){margin-bottom:90px}.highlight{color:#00d15f}.align-center{text-align:center}.header{position:relative;z-index:1;min-height:646px;color:#fff}.header:last-child{margin-bottom:80px}.header__wrapper{display:grid;grid-template-columns:minmax(15px,auto) minmax(auto,710px) minmax(350px,495px) minmax(15px,auto);grid-template-rows:40px minmax(450px,auto) 0;gap:40px 25px}.header__bgr{grid-column:1/-1;grid-row:1/3;background:#010101 -webkit-image-set(url(https://cdn.veeam.com/content/dam/veeam/global/go/projects/2026/ransomware-prevention-kit/img/background_image_v2_1920x640.jpg) 1x,url(https://cdn.veeam.com/content/dam/veeam/global/go/projects/2026/ransomware-prevention-kit/img/background_image_v2_1920x640_2x.jpg) 2x) no-repeat center/cover;background:#010101 image-set(url(https://cdn.veeam.com/content/dam/veeam/global/go/projects/2026/ransomware-prevention-kit/img/background_image_v2_1920x640.jpg) 1x,url(https://cdn.veeam.com/content/dam/veeam/global/go/projects/2026/ransomware-prevention-kit/img/background_image_v2_1920x640_2x.jpg) 2x) no-repeat center/cover}.header__promo-part{position:relative;z-index:1;grid-column:2/3;grid-row:2/3;padding-bottom:116px}.header__form-part,.header__spacer{position:relative;z-index:1;grid-column:3/4;grid-row:2/-1}.header__spacer{background:#fff;z-index:0;grid-column:1/-1;grid-row:4/-1;height:100px}.header__logo{display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:80px}.header__veeam-logo{width:230px;height:auto}.header__title{font-size:60px;line-height:60px;font-weight:700}.header__subtitle:not(:last-child),.header__title:not(:last-child){margin-bottom:32px}.header__subtitle{font-size:36px;line-height:44px;font-weight:700;color:#32f26f}.header-list{font-size:20px;line-height:24px}ul.header-list .header-list__item:before{top:8px}.form,.main{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}.main{position:relative;margin:40px 0 80px;gap:80px}.main::after{content:"";position:absolute;bottom:-80px;right:0;width:248px;height:205px;background:url(https://cdn.veeam.com/content/dam/veeam/global/go/projects/2026/ransomware-prevention-kit/img/graphic_right_bottom.svg) bottom right/contain no-repeat}[class^=footer-v] .footer{max-width:1230px}.form{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;width:100%;min-height:630px;padding:32px 44px 48px;background:#fff;color:#232323;border-radius:4px;-webkit-box-shadow:-8px 12px 36px 0 rgba(0,0,0,.06),-8px 10px 4px 0 rgba(0,0,0,.01),-16px 36px 52px 0 rgba(80,88,97,.18);box-shadow:-8px 12px 36px 0 rgba(0,0,0,.06),-8px 10px 4px 0 rgba(0,0,0,.01),-16px 36px 52px 0 rgba(80,88,97,.18);backdrop-filter:blur(15px)}.form__wrapper{width:100%;text-align:left}.form__title{margin-bottom:16px;font-size:28px;line-height:36px;font-weight:600;color:#000;text-align:center}.success{display:none}.success__title{margin-bottom:24px;font-size:28px;line-height:36px;text-align:center}.intro{margin-bottom:80px;text-align:center}.intro--no-margin{margin-bottom:0}.intro__title{max-width:1124px;margin:auto;font-size:36px;line-height:44px;font-weight:700}.content,.content__wrapper{display:-webkit-box;display:-ms-flexbox;display:flex}.content{position:relative;z-index:2;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:80px}.content__wrapper{gap:30px;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-ms-flex-pack:distribute;justify-content:space-around;width:100%}.content__img{width:100%;height:auto}.content__img-link,.content__wp-img{display:-webkit-box;display:-ms-flexbox;display:flex;margin:0 auto;border:10px solid #f9f9f9;-webkit-box-shadow:16px 48px 62px 0 rgba(0,0,0,.07),12px 23px 24px 0 rgba(0,0,0,.05);box-shadow:16px 48px 62px 0 rgba(0,0,0,.07),12px 23px 24px 0 rgba(0,0,0,.05);border-radius:6px}.content__wp-img{width:100%;max-width:390px}.content__img-link{position:relative}.content__img-link :active,.content__img-link :visited,.content__img-link:hover{cursor:pointer}.content__img-link :active::before,.content__img-link :visited::before,.content__img-link:hover::before{background:rgba(255,255,255,.9);border-color:rgba(55,0,255,.9)}.content__img-link::after,.content__img-link::before{content:"";position:absolute;top: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.content__img-link::before{left:50%;width:78px;height:72px;margin:auto;border-radius:10px;border:3px solid rgba(55,0,255,.7);background:rgba(255,255,255,.7);backdrop-filter:blur(1.5px);-webkit-transition:all .2s ease-out;transition:all .2s ease-out}.content__img-link::after{left:calc(50% + 2.5px);width:32px;height:37px;background:url(https://cdn.veeam.com/content/dam/veeam/global/go/projects/2026/ransomware-prevention-kit/img/icon_play.svg) no-repeat center center/contain}.content__title{font-size:14px;line-height:20px;font-weight:400;text-align:center}.content__resource-wrapper{max-width:320px;width:100%}.content__resource-wrapper:nth-child(1),.content__resource-wrapper:nth-child(2){max-width:250px}.content__note{font-size:28px;line-height:36px;text-align:center}.cards{margin-bottom:80px}.cards__wrapper{display:-webkit-box;display:-ms-flexbox;display:flex;gap:30px;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between}.cards__title{margin-bottom:32px;font-size:44px;line-height:52px;font-weight:700;text-align:center}.cards__item{-ms-flex-preferred-size:585px;flex-basis:585px;padding:32px 15px;border-top:4px solid #00d15f;border-radius:6px;background:#f9f9f9}.cards__item-title{margin-bottom:8px;font-size:20px;line-height:24px;font-weight:600}.cards__item-description{font-size:16px;line-height:24px;font-weight:400}.noscroll{overflow:hidden}.popup{display:none}.popup--show{position:fixed;z-index:9999;top:0;left:0;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;width:100%;height:100%;overflow:auto;background:rgba(35,35,35,.95)}.popup--show::-webkit-scrollbar{width:0;display:none}.popup--show::-webkit-scrollbar-button{display:none}.popup--show::-webkit-scrollbar-thumb{display:none}.popup__close{position:fixed;top:0;right:0;z-index:9999;width:100vw;height:100vh;cursor:default}.popup__close-icon{position:fixed;top:0;right:0;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;padding:50px;cursor:pointer;-webkit-transition:.3s;transition:.3s}.popup__close-icon:hover{-webkit-transform:scale(1.2);transform:scale(1.2)}.popup__close-icon::after,.popup__close-icon::before{background:#32f26f;content:"";position:absolute;width:50px;height:2px;-webkit-transform:rotate(45deg);transform:rotate(45deg)}.popup__close-icon::after{-webkit-transform:rotate(-45deg);transform:rotate(-45deg)}.popup__youtube-iframe{display:block;position:fixed;z-index:9999;width:100%;height:100%;max-width:1000px;max-height:562.5px;margin:auto;border:0}.popup__wistia-embed-wrapper{position:relative;z-index:10000;width:100%;max-width:1000px;height:auto;margin-right:15px;margin-left:15px}.about{text-align:center}.about__content{max-width:1150px;margin:auto}.about__title{margin-bottom:32px;font-size:44px;line-height:52px;font-weight:700}.about__description{font-size:24px;line-height:28px}.banner,.banner__content{position:relative;margin-left:auto;margin-right:auto}.banner{z-index:1;max-width:1390px;width:calc(100% - 30px);padding:80px 0;color:#fff;background:#010101;border-radius:6px}.banner::before{content:"";position:absolute;bottom:0;z-index:2;width:100%;height:100%;background:#010101 -webkit-image-set(url(https://cdn.veeam.com/content/dam/veeam/global/go/projects/2026/ransomware-prevention-kit/img/cta_block_background_1390x248.jpg) 1x,url(https://cdn.veeam.com/content/dam/veeam/global/go/projects/2026/ransomware-prevention-kit/img/cta_block_background_1390x248_2x.jpg) 2x) center bottom no-repeat;background:#010101 image-set(url(https://cdn.veeam.com/content/dam/veeam/global/go/projects/2026/ransomware-prevention-kit/img/cta_block_background_1390x248.jpg) 1x,url(https://cdn.veeam.com/content/dam/veeam/global/go/projects/2026/ransomware-prevention-kit/img/cta_block_background_1390x248_2x.jpg) 2x) center bottom no-repeat;background-size:cover;border-radius:6px}.banner__content{z-index:3;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-column-gap:50px;-moz-column-gap:50px;column-gap:50px;row-gap:32px}.banner__title{font-size:44px;line-height:52px;font-weight:700;-ms-flex-negative:1;flex-shrink:1}.banner__title:not(:last-child){margin-bottom:16px}.banner__text-part{-ms-flex-negative:1;flex-shrink:1;-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1}.banner__cta-part{-ms-flex-preferred-size:260px;flex-basis:260px;-ms-flex-negative:0;flex-shrink:0;-webkit-box-flex:0;-ms-flex-positive:0;flex-grow:0;text-align:right}@media screen and (max-width:1420px){.banner{margin:0 15px}}@media screen and (max-width:1280px){.header__title{font-size:56px;line-height:56px}.main::after{display:none}.form{margin-left:auto;margin-right:auto;width:100%;max-width:495px}.cards,.intro{margin-bottom:40px}.cards__item{-ms-flex-preferred-size:calc(50% - 30px);flex-basis:calc(50% - 30px)}}@media screen and (max-width:1024px){.header__wrapper{grid-template-columns:minmax(15px,auto) minmax(auto,635px) minmax(auto,495px) minmax(15px,auto);grid-template-rows:auto minmax(450px,auto) auto}.header__promo-part{grid-column:2/4;padding-bottom:40px}.header__form-part{grid-column:2/4;grid-row:3/-1}.header__title{font-size:52px;line-height:52px}.header__subtitle{max-width:774px}.form{min-height:300px}.content{gap:40px}.content__wrapper{-ms-flex-wrap:wrap;flex-wrap:wrap}.content__resource-wrapper{max-width:390px}.content__resource-wrapper:nth-child(1),.content__resource-wrapper:nth-child(2){max-width:390px}.cards__title{font-size:32px;line-height:40px}.cards__item{-ms-flex-preferred-size:100%;flex-basis:100%}.popup__youtube-iframe{max-width:90vw;max-height:50.625vw}.about__title{font-size:32px;line-height:40px}.about__description{font-size:22px;line-height:26px}.banner{padding:40px 0}.banner__title{font-size:27px;line-height:35px}}@media screen and (max-width:768px){.title-size-m{font-size:32px;line-height:40px;font-weight:700}.title-size-l{font-size:48px;line-height:56px}.title-size-xl{font-size:56px;line-height:64px}.push-size-s:not(:last-child){margin-bottom:24px}.push-size-m:not(:last-child){margin-bottom:32px}.push-size-l:not(:last-child){margin-bottom:40px}.push-size-xl:not(:last-child){margin-bottom:48px}.push-size-xxl:not(:last-child),.push-size-xxxl:not(:last-child),.push-size-xxxxl:not(:last-child),.push-size-xxxxxl:not(:last-child){margin-bottom:56px}.header:last-child{margin-bottom:56px}.header__logo{margin-bottom:56px}.header__title{font-size:48px;line-height:48px}.header__subtitle:not(:last-child),.header__title:not(:last-child){margin-bottom:24px}.header__subtitle{max-width:620px;font-size:32px;line-height:40px}.header-list{font-size:18px;line-height:22px}.main{margin:40px 0;gap:40px}.form__title{text-align:center}.success__title{margin-bottom:20px;font-size:24px;line-height:32px}.intro__title{font-size:32px;line-height:40px}.popup__close-icon{padding:25px}.banner{max-height:none}.banner__content{-ms-flex-wrap:wrap;flex-wrap:wrap;text-align:center}.banner__cta-part,.banner__text-part{-ms-flex-preferred-size:100%;flex-basis:100%}.banner__cta-part{text-align:center}}@media screen and (max-width:480px){.title-size-xs{font-size:20px;line-height:28px}.title-size-s{font-size:24px;line-height:32px}.title-size-m{font-size:28px;line-height:36px;font-weight:700}.title-size-l{font-size:40px;line-height:48px}.title-size-xl{font-size:52px;line-height:60px}.push-size-m:not(:last-child){margin-bottom:24px}.push-size-l:not(:last-child){margin-bottom:32px}.push-size-xl:not(:last-child),.push-size-xxl:not(:last-child),.push-size-xxxl:not(:last-child),.push-size-xxxxl:not(:last-child),.push-size-xxxxxl:not(:last-child){margin-bottom:40px}.hide--480{display:none}.header:last-child{margin-bottom:40px}.header__wrapper{gap:40px 0}.header__logo{margin-bottom:40px}.header__veeam-logo{width:138px}.header__title{font-size:42px;line-height:42px}.header__subtitle{font-size:28px;line-height:36px}.form{padding:24px 24px 32px}.form__title{font-size:24px;line-height:32px}.success__title{margin-bottom:16px;font-size:22px;line-height:30px}.intro__title{font-size:24px;line-height:32px}.content__img-link,.content__wp-img{margin-bottom:16px}.about__title,.cards__title{font-size:24px;line-height:32px}.about__description{font-size:21px;line-height:25px}.banner__title{font-size:28px;line-height:36px}}@media screen and (max-width:375px){.header__subtitle{font-size:24px;line-height:32px}.about__title,.cards__title,.intro__title{font-size:21px;line-height:29px}.about__description{font-size:18px;line-height:26px}}